Understanding the 450mm Gate Valve A Comprehensive Overview
Gate valves are essential components in various industrial applications, serving primarily as on/off switches that control the flow of liquids and gases through pipelines. Among the various sizes and types available, the 450mm gate valve stands out due to its significant diameter and robust design, making it suitable for larger systems where efficient flow control is crucial.
What is a Gate Valve?
A gate valve is a linear motion valve that features a gate (or wedge) that moves perpendicularly to the flow of fluid. This design provides minimal flow resistance when the valve is fully open, allowing for optimal fluid flow. When the gate is lowered into the flow path, it creates a tight seal, making the valve ideal for applications requiring complete closure.
Applications of the 450mm Gate Valve
The 450mm gate valve is commonly found in various sectors, including
1. Water Supply and Distribution Large municipal water systems often utilize 450mm gate valves for controlling water flow in pipelines. Their size allows for high-volume flow rates, essential for maintaining efficient water distribution.
2. Wastewater Management In sewage and wastewater treatment facilities, these valves are crucial for managing the flow of waste. They help prevent backflow and allow for maintenance operations without having to shut down entire systems.
3. Industrial Processes In manufacturing and processing plants, the 450mm gate valve regulates the flow of liquids and gases in large pipelines. Their robust construction ensures durability in demanding environments.
4. Fire Protection Systems These valves can be part of fire sprinkler systems, allowing firefighters to control the water supply to various sections of a facility quickly.
Key Features of the 450mm Gate Valve
1. Robust Construction Gate valves of this size are typically made from materials such as ductile iron, stainless steel, or alloy steel, providing excellent resistance to corrosion and wear.
2. Sealing Mechanism The sealing mechanism usually consists of resilient materials such as rubber or Teflon, ensuring a tight seal when the valve is closed, thus preventing leakage.
3. Low Pressure Drop When fully open, gate valves offer minimal resistance to fluid flow, making them efficient for systems requiring high flow rates.
4. Manual or Automated Operation Depending on the application, a 450mm gate valve can be operated manually via a handwheel or integrated into an automated control system for enhanced operational efficiency.
Maintenance and Operation
To ensure longevity and optimal performance, regular maintenance of the 450mm gate valve is necessary. This includes
- Visual Inspections Regular checks for signs of wear, corrosion, and leaks help detect issues early.
- Lubrication Moving parts that are not in constant operation should be lubricated to prevent rusting and facilitate smooth operation.
- Periodic Testing Testing the valve’s operation under normal conditions ensures it will function effectively when needed.
Properly training personnel on the operation of gate valves is crucial, as improper handling can lead to operational failures or accidents.
